[05:27:59] 10Continuous-Integration-Infrastructure, 10Release-Engineering-Team: docs.wikimedia.org (alias) should preserve path upon redirect to https://doc.wikimedia.org/ - https://phabricator.wikimedia.org/T213374 (10Krinkle) [05:28:14] 10Continuous-Integration-Infrastructure, 10Release-Engineering-Team: docs.wikimedia.org (alias) should preserve path upon redirect to https://doc.wikimedia.org/ - https://phabricator.wikimedia.org/T213374 (10Krinkle) [07:19:02] (03PS6) 10Krinkle: Fix nyc and npm-update bugs due to unwritable HOME [integration/config] - 10https://gerrit.wikimedia.org/r/482527 (https://phabricator.wikimedia.org/T212602) [07:19:33] (03CR) 10Krinkle: "@Hashar Could you re-review?" [integration/config] - 10https://gerrit.wikimedia.org/r/482527 (https://phabricator.wikimedia.org/T212602) (owner: 10Krinkle) [08:01:41] 10Continuous-Integration-Infrastructure, 10Release-Engineering-Team: docs.wikimedia.org (alias) should preserve path upon redirect to https://doc.wikimedia.org/ - https://phabricator.wikimedia.org/T213374 (10hashar) 05Open→03Declined The alias got setup by T100349 and, If I remember well, the alias `docs`... [08:37:08] (03CR) 10Thiemo Kreuz (WMDE): [C: 03+1] "Off topic: Oh my god, we still have code that uses ?> 10Continuous-Integration-Config, 10Continuous-Integration-Infrastructure (Slipway): Migrate integration-zuul-layoutdiff and integration-zuul-layoutvalidation-gate jobs to Docker containers - https://phabricator.wikimedia.org/T210279 (10hashar) [10:27:52] 10Release-Engineering-Team (Backlog), 10ORES, 10Operations, 10Scoring-platform-team, 10Release Pipeline (Blubber): The continuous release pipeline should support more than one service per repo - https://phabricator.wikimedia.org/T210267 (10Ladsgroup) >>! In T210267#4860670, @Ottomata wrote: > Q: would bl... [10:47:39] 10Continuous-Integration-Infrastructure (Slipway), 10Lexicographical data, 10Wikidata, 10Browser-Tests, 10User-zeljkofilipin: Migrate selenium-Wikibase-chrome selenium-WikibaseLexeme-chrome to Docker containers - https://phabricator.wikimedia.org/T210285 (10Ladsgroup) >>! In T210285#4866075, @zeljkofilip... [12:44:39] (03PS1) 10QChris: Allow “Gerrit Managers” to import history [skins/Anisa] (refs/meta/config) - 10https://gerrit.wikimedia.org/r/483399 [12:44:41] (03CR) 10QChris: [V: 03+2 C: 03+2] Allow “Gerrit Managers” to import history [skins/Anisa] (refs/meta/config) - 10https://gerrit.wikimedia.org/r/483399 (owner: 10QChris) [12:45:02] (03PS1) 10QChris: Import done. Revoke import grants [skins/Anisa] (refs/meta/config) - 10https://gerrit.wikimedia.org/r/483400 [12:45:06] (03CR) 10QChris: [V: 03+2 C: 03+2] Import done. Revoke import grants [skins/Anisa] (refs/meta/config) - 10https://gerrit.wikimedia.org/r/483400 (owner: 10QChris) [12:52:03] 10Project-Admins: Requests for addition to the #acl*Project-Admins group (in comments) - https://phabricator.wikimedia.org/T706 (10Niharika) Hi. I would like to ask to be added to #acl_project-admins because I need to frequently create new projects for CommTech projects and update herald rules for our projects.... [13:13:27] 10Project-Admins: Requests for addition to the #acl*Project-Admins group (in comments) - https://phabricator.wikimedia.org/T706 (10Aklapper) @Niharika: Here you go :) [15:10:39] 10Continuous-Integration-Config, 10Continuous-Integration-Infrastructure (Slipway), 10Release-Engineering-Team (Kanban): Migrate integration-zuul-layoutdiff and integration-zuul-layoutvalidation-gate jobs to Docker containers - https://phabricator.wikimedia.org/T210279 (10hashar) a:03hashar [16:08:37] (03PS1) 10Hashar: Port zuul layout related jobs to Docker [integration/config] - 10https://gerrit.wikimedia.org/r/483450 (https://phabricator.wikimedia.org/T210279) [16:08:54] (03CR) 10Hashar: [C: 03+2] Port zuul layout related jobs to Docker [integration/config] - 10https://gerrit.wikimedia.org/r/483450 (https://phabricator.wikimedia.org/T210279) (owner: 10Hashar) [16:11:38] (03Merged) 10jenkins-bot: Port zuul layout related jobs to Docker [integration/config] - 10https://gerrit.wikimedia.org/r/483450 (https://phabricator.wikimedia.org/T210279) (owner: 10Hashar) [16:13:30] (03CR) 10Hashar: [C: 03+2] "check experimental" [integration/config] - 10https://gerrit.wikimedia.org/r/483450 (https://phabricator.wikimedia.org/T210279) (owner: 10Hashar) [16:17:20] (03CR) 10jenkins-bot: Port zuul layout related jobs to Docker [integration/config] - 10https://gerrit.wikimedia.org/r/483450 (https://phabricator.wikimedia.org/T210279) (owner: 10Hashar) [16:23:11] (03PS1) 10Hashar: utils: setup-zuul, stop using tox -qq (need 3.0.0+) [integration/config] - 10https://gerrit.wikimedia.org/r/483460 [16:23:25] (03CR) 10Hashar: "check experimental" [integration/config] - 10https://gerrit.wikimedia.org/r/483460 (owner: 10Hashar) [16:24:26] 10Continuous-Integration-Infrastructure: CI: upgrade tox, currently running 2.6.0 - https://phabricator.wikimedia.org/T196628 (10hashar) This is overdue and should be done. I eventually had the use case for `-q` (--quiet) which got introduced in version 3.0.0. [16:24:34] 10Continuous-Integration-Infrastructure, 10Release-Engineering-Team (Kanban): CI: upgrade tox, currently running 2.6.0 - https://phabricator.wikimedia.org/T196628 (10hashar) [16:25:25] 10Project-Admins: Requests for addition to the #acl*Project-Admins group (in comments) - https://phabricator.wikimedia.org/T706 (10Niharika) >>! In T706#4869397, @Aklapper wrote: > @Niharika: Here you go :) Thank you! [16:28:32] 10Continuous-Integration-Infrastructure, 10Release-Engineering-Team (Kanban): CI: upgrade tox, currently running 2.6.0 - https://phabricator.wikimedia.org/T196628 (10hashar) [16:30:15] (03CR) 10Hashar: [C: 03+2] utils: setup-zuul, stop using tox -qq (need 3.0.0+) [integration/config] - 10https://gerrit.wikimedia.org/r/483460 (owner: 10Hashar) [16:31:31] 10Release-Engineering-Team (Kanban), 10Code-Health-Metrics, 10Patch-For-Review, 10User-zeljkofilipin: Code health metrics spike - https://phabricator.wikimedia.org/T207046 (10zeljkofilipin) [16:32:54] (03Merged) 10jenkins-bot: utils: setup-zuul, stop using tox -qq (need 3.0.0+) [integration/config] - 10https://gerrit.wikimedia.org/r/483460 (owner: 10Hashar) [16:40:03] (03PS1) 10Hashar: docker: bump tox 2.6.0..2.9.1 [integration/config] - 10https://gerrit.wikimedia.org/r/483464 (https://phabricator.wikimedia.org/T196628) [16:40:47] (03CR) 10Hashar: "That is overdue. I guess I will do that on Monday morning." [integration/config] - 10https://gerrit.wikimedia.org/r/483464 (https://phabricator.wikimedia.org/T196628) (owner: 10Hashar) [16:42:50] 10Continuous-Integration-Infrastructure, 10Release-Engineering-Team (Kanban), 10Patch-For-Review: CI: upgrade tox, currently running 2.6.0 - https://phabricator.wikimedia.org/T196628 (10hashar) a:03hashar [16:43:23] 10Continuous-Integration-Infrastructure, 10Release-Engineering-Team (Kanban), 10Patch-For-Review: CI: upgrade tox, currently running 2.6.0 - https://phabricator.wikimedia.org/T196628 (10hashar) p:05Triage→03Low [16:46:41] 10Continuous-Integration-Config, 10Continuous-Integration-Infrastructure (Slipway), 10Release-Engineering-Team (Kanban), 10Patch-For-Review: Migrate integration-zuul-layoutdiff and integration-zuul-layoutvalidation-gate jobs to Docker containers - https://phabricator.wikimedia.org/T210279 (10hashar) That w... [16:59:46] 10Phabricator: Can I change my username here? - https://phabricator.wikimedia.org/T96110 (10Krishna_Chaitanya_Velaga) Is there any progress on this? I mean, can users be renamed without losing their previous actions, like on Wikimedia project? [18:12:34] (03CR) 10VolkerE: [C: 03+1] "Who can merge this?" [integration/config] - 10https://gerrit.wikimedia.org/r/482755 (https://phabricator.wikimedia.org/T187672) (owner: 10Krinkle) [18:16:47] (03CR) 10Krinkle: "https://gerrit.wikimedia.org/r/#/admin/groups/10,members" [integration/config] - 10https://gerrit.wikimedia.org/r/482755 (https://phabricator.wikimedia.org/T187672) (owner: 10Krinkle) [18:17:37] (03CR) 10Krinkle: "(note that this repo is primarily a log of deployments, it is not itself, the thing that is deployed; that is to say, I need to upload it " [integration/config] - 10https://gerrit.wikimedia.org/r/482755 (https://phabricator.wikimedia.org/T187672) (owner: 10Krinkle) [20:19:17] (03CR) 10Umherirrender: "Generic.Files.InlineHTML would conflict in skins, so I am not sure that is possible - needs further checks" [tools/codesniffer] - 10https://gerrit.wikimedia.org/r/482375 (owner: 10Umherirrender) [20:54:30] twentyafterfour: Want me to land https://gerrit.wikimedia.org/r/c/mediawiki/core/+/483511 ? [20:55:10] James_F: sure. I'm sort of fishing for someone's blessing before I make the final tarballs [20:55:23] :-) [20:55:27] I think I should have greg-g bless it before I make it official though [20:55:34] but land away :) [21:01:29] Done. [21:35:29] (03PS1) 10Mholloway: Add CI jobs for new ConfigurableCounters extension [integration/config] - 10https://gerrit.wikimedia.org/r/483527 [21:50:16] twentyafterfour: https://gerrit.wikimedia.org/r/c/mediawiki/core/+/483599 :-) [21:55:25] ftpr (for the public record): gesundheit to the release [21:55:35] cc James_F ^ :) [21:55:52] Yay. [22:13:07] WOO [22:13:13] greg-g: and James_F only broke 1 thing [22:13:15] :D [22:13:25] Have you fixed it yet? [22:13:36] No, because CI is slow and MCR is hard. [22:13:46] But the code is merging to wmf.12 now. [22:19:03] * Hauskatze is trying to figure out how to translate 'slot' for MediaWiki core [22:22:04] what context? [22:28:49] Hauskatze: Which language? [22:29:11] James_F: 'es', and MediaWiki core [22:29:18] ie content not allowed in this slot [22:29:24] Hauskatze: Is it not already translated? Huh. [22:29:32] nope [22:29:48] I cannot find a word that makes sense [22:29:51] location? [22:30:01] slot sounds like those gambing machines [22:30:09] *gambling [22:30:36] Hauskatze: On old gaming consoles, what word would you use to say "I can save up to four games, one in each of the slots on the memory card"? [22:31:39] Y'know, I've never had any gaming console... [22:31:46] Or what do you call the slot you put a memory card into? [22:31:49] "sd card slot" [22:31:56] I'd say 'ranura' [22:32:03] I guess "reader" in those cases potentially [22:32:43] google says ranura == groove [22:35:11] space? [22:35:30] as in "you cannot save this content in this space" [22:35:54] could work [22:36:07] Obviously, translations don't need to be perfect :) [22:36:31] Yeah, I just want that they make sense to the readers [22:36:40] w/o loosing its context ofc [22:38:51] here is how Nintendo translates saving a game in "slot A" https://es-americas-support.nintendo.com/app/answers/detail/a_id/24249/~/c%C3%B3mo-guardar-el-progreso-de-juego-%5Bsuper-nes-classic-edition%5D [22:38:57] "ranura" confirmed [22:43:44] mutante: 'ranura' is a hole [22:44:23] like those of the mail boxes [22:46:40] (03CR) 10Rush: [V: 03+2 C: 03+2] Edit Project Config [wikimedia/security] (refs/meta/config) - 10https://gerrit.wikimedia.org/r/483174 (owner: 10Rush) [22:47:05] Hauskatze: i specifically searched for Spanish translation of it in the video game context and "save slots". it also translate it back to "save slot" on Google [22:48:06] Si no hay ranuras de guardado disponibles .. | If there are no save slots available ... [22:48:23] Yep, in that context 'ranuras' make sense. [22:59:28] https://integration.wikimedia.org/ci/login uses the same credentials as in Wikitech? [23:03:06] Hauskatze: yes, for me it does [23:03:07] Hauskatze: Any time a real end-user sees that message, the world is on fire. It doesn't need to be too simple. [23:04:33] 10Release-Engineering-Team, 10Analytics, 10Scoring-platform-team: Investigate formal test framework for Oozie jobs - https://phabricator.wikimedia.org/T213496 (10awight) [23:09:05] 10Release-Engineering-Team, 10Analytics, 10Scoring-platform-team: Investigate formal test framework for Oozie jobs - https://phabricator.wikimedia.org/T213496 (10awight) One alternative is a JUnit class meant for workflow and coordinator testing: http://oozie.apache.org/docs/5.1.0/ENG_MiniOozie.html An exa... [23:13:19] mutante: thanks :) [23:13:56] James_F: I've asked my colleagues at translatewiki. I think 'espacio' would be best but when in doubt, ask first I think [23:14:24] * James_F grins. [23:25:43] mutante: access denied to manually schedule a job, apparently I need to be added to something else [23:36:03] 10Beta-Cluster-Infrastructure, 10Performance-Team: Move XHGui from tungsten to webperf-002 - https://phabricator.wikimedia.org/T180761 (10Krinkle) The xhgui role (to become a profile or regular class) currently fails to provision on webperf12 in Beta (and presumably would fail as-is on webperf002 in prod as we... [23:47:42] (03PS3) 10Krinkle: Add Jenkins jobs for jsdoc/wmf-theme (npm-test; Node 10) [integration/config] - 10https://gerrit.wikimedia.org/r/482755 (https://phabricator.wikimedia.org/T187672) [23:52:33] (03PS4) 10Krinkle: Create generic npm-test job for Node 10 (and use for jsdoc/wmf-theme) [integration/config] - 10https://gerrit.wikimedia.org/r/482755 (https://phabricator.wikimedia.org/T187672) [23:54:12] (03CR) 10Krinkle: [C: 03+2] "Compiled and uploaded generic-node10-docker" [integration/config] - 10https://gerrit.wikimedia.org/r/482755 (https://phabricator.wikimedia.org/T187672) (owner: 10Krinkle) [23:55:27] (03CR) 10Thcipriani: [C: 03+2] Tweaked logo to play nice with preview renderer on commons [blubber] - 10https://gerrit.wikimedia.org/r/483298 (owner: 10Dduvall) [23:56:08] Hauskatze: i dont know what it is specifically, maybe the same trusted user list or an LDAP group [23:56:15] (03Merged) 10jenkins-bot: Tweaked logo to play nice with preview renderer on commons [blubber] - 10https://gerrit.wikimedia.org/r/483298 (owner: 10Dduvall) [23:56:30] Hauskatze: ask Antoine tomorrow [23:56:48] Ok :) [23:57:05] legoktm: James_F: is there a task for the npm6 and/or node10 migration on CI? [23:57:21] https://phabricator.wikimedia.org/T213500 - any phab admins? [23:57:55] Krinkle: T211784 is for "move to npm6 everywhere", but there's not a CI-infra "be able to move" task. [23:57:56] T211784: Upgrade all CI jobs from npm3 to npm6 across all projects - https://phabricator.wikimedia.org/T211784 [23:58:09] (03CR) 10jenkins-bot: Tweaked logo to play nice with preview renderer on commons [blubber] - 10https://gerrit.wikimedia.org/r/483298 (owner: 10Dduvall) [23:58:18] Krenair: disabled [23:58:20] ty [23:58:38] James_F: OK. Should we conceptually merge/repurpose that for node10 everywhere? [23:59:03] I'm looking at a few non-mw uses now that already adopted npm6 to put them on node10 instead. [23:59:09] Krinkle: Sure, node10+npm>=5.6 is fine from our needs. [23:59:45] 10Continuous-Integration-Config, 10JavaScript: Upgrade all CI jobs from node6/npm3 to node10/npm6 across all projects - https://phabricator.wikimedia.org/T211784 (10Krinkle)